Bonnie, 89, and Donnie, 88, had been married for about 70 years when Bonnie died of complications from COVID-19 in December 2020. They raised four kids together and doted on a gaggle of grandchildren and great-grandchildren.
After graduation, the couple set out to start their own family. Their first two children were born prematurely and died shortly after birth. Their next four, also born prematurely, were luckily healthy. And so began their busy lives.
